Titre : Teaching Young Learners English From Theory to Practice Type de document : texte imprimé Auteurs : Joan Kang Shin, Auteur ; Jo Ann Crandall, Auteur Editeur : National Geographic Learning Année de publication : 2013. Importance : 401p. Présentation : couv. ill. en coul. Format : 27 cm. ISBN/ISSN/EAN : 978-1-111-77137-9 Langues : Anglais (eng) Tags : Teaching english Young learners basic principles contextualizing instruction teaching listening teaching speaking teaching reading teaching writing storytelling assessement classroom management first century professional development Index. décimale : 428 Standardizd use of the Englishe language- Applied Linguistics Résumé : Teaching Young Learners English focuses on teaching English as a foreign language to children aged 7-12. It presents foundational concepts, best practices and practical suggestions on how to develop lessons and activities for the energetic and curious minds of young learners in the 21st Century classroom. It also features the perspectives and suggestions from practicing teachers around the world, and can be used as a basic text for prospective teachers or as a professional development tool for teachers and administrators wishing to develop the knowledge and skills to teach English to young learners.
